LEPERS AT MAKOGAI
DONATIONS TO CHRISTMAS FUND Mr P. J. Twomey, of the Christchurch Gas Company, acknowledges the following donations to the fund for providing Christmas cheer for the lepers on Makogai Island:—
Also gramophone and records, harp, jig-saw puzzles, annuals, games, sewing silks, embroidery cottons, etc., soap, sweets, pipes, tobacco and tools from: Sympathisers (4), Friends (3), No Name (3), Mrs Wm. Farnie, Mrs L. A. Woodward, Misses Buss, Mrs Smith, Wm. Rowe, A.T., Mr G. E. Rhodes, P. B. O'Connor, D. Halliday.
